The Utah House passed several bills on Feb. 26, 2013 — including concurrence with Senate amendments to property-tax bills and floor passage of bills on tattoo-industry regulation, Medicaid oversight, school trust funds, and off-highway vehicle fees. Tallies and next steps are listed.

During the Feb. 26 House floor session members recorded final votes and procedural actions on a number of bills. Not all items received full debate on the floor; the House recorded final tallies and referrals as follows.

Key floor votes and outcomes

- First substitute House Bill 67 (property taxation revisions): House concurred with Senate amendments; final passage vote recorded as 71 yes, 0 no. (To be returned to the Senate for the president's signature.)
